Vaccinations: Maintaining Your Pet Dog Protected
Exactly how can vaccinations guard a pet's wellness? Vaccinations play a crucial duty in preventing various transmittable diseases that can impact animals. Board Certified Veterinary Cardiologist. By promoting the immune system, injections prepare a pet's body to ward off particular virus. Usual vaccinations include those for rabies, distemper, parvovirus, and feline leukemia.Pet owners need to consult their veterinarian to establish the suitable vaccination timetable based upon their family pet's health, age, and way of life status. Normal inoculations not just secure individual family pets yet additionally add to herd resistance, decreasing the spread of illness within the community.During a veterinary check out, the vet will certainly review the benefits of each vaccine and any type of prospective adverse effects. Maintaining inoculations as much as day is crucial for a pet dog's lasting health and wellness and health. This aggressive technique warranties that pet dogs continue to be shielded versus severe ailments throughout their lives
Analysis Tests: Comprehending Your Animal's Health
Analysis examinations are integral to examining a family pet's total wellness and determining potential medical issues. These examinations can range from simple blood job to sophisticated imaging methods, offering vets with crucial information concerning a family pet's interior systems. Blood tests, as an example, can reveal body organ feature, discover infections, and indicate hidden illness. Urinalysis provides understandings into kidney health and wellness and metabolic conditions. Furthermore, X-rays and ultrasounds enable a non-invasive consider bones and soft tissues, aiding diagnose growths, cracks, or abnormalities.veterinarians may advise diagnostic tests based upon a pet dog's age, breed, and case history, in addition to any symptoms provided throughout the evaluation. Understanding the function of these examinations can relieve pet proprietors' concerns, ensuring they are well-informed concerning their pet's wellness trip. Inevitably, these assessments play a vital role in precautionary treatment and allowing timely interventions for any kind of spotted health problems.

Usual Oral Concerns
Several pets experience dental problems that can considerably affect their total health and well-being. Typical dental troubles include periodontal illness, which results from the accumulation of plaque and tartar, resulting in periodontal inflammation and prospective tooth loss. Various other constant problems are tooth fractures, typically brought on by eating difficult objects, and gingivitis, defined by inflamed gums and bad breath. Furthermore, pet dogs might struggle with maintained primary teeth, which can create and misalign adult teeth discomfort. Oral tumors, although much less typical, can likewise position significant health and wellness dangers. Recognizing these dental concerns early is essential, as they can result in much more severe systemic health worries if left unattended. Normal vet check-ups are essential for preserving pets' oral health and protecting against these usual troubles.
Preventive Treatment Methods
Preserving excellent dental hygiene is vital for avoiding the common problems described previously. Normal dental check-ups and cleanings are essential parts of preventive care techniques, permitting veterinarians to determine and attend to potential issues early. Routine brushing in your home, utilizing pet-specific tooth paste, can considerably decrease plaque build-up and tartar formation. Furthermore, dental deals with and toys developed to promote oral wellness can help in keeping clean teeth and fresh breath. Proprietors need to likewise be alert for signs of dental condition, such as foul breath or problem consuming, as early treatment can protect against a lot more significant health problems. Generally, an aggressive technique to dental care not just enhances the family pet's lifestyle yet additionally adds to their total health and wellness and durability.

Frequently Asked Concerns

How Can I Prepare My Pet for a Veterinary See?
To prepare a pet for a vet go to, the proprietor ought to ensure the family pet is calm, bring acquainted items, upgrade inoculation documents, and give a list of issues or signs and symptoms for the vet.

What Should I Bring to My Pet dog's Appointment?
For a family pet's visit, it is vital to bring inoculation documents, a listing of existing medications, any type of relevant case history, and a comfortable copyright or chain. These items ensure a smooth and efficient check out for both pet and vet.
How Commonly Should My Animal Have Exams?
The frequency of animal exams normally depends on age and health standing. Generally, annual check outs are advised for healthy adult pet dogs, while younger or elderly pets might require even more regular analyses to monitor their well-being.
Can I Stick With My Animal During Procedures?
Lots of veterinary centers permit pet owners to remain with their animals throughout procedures, though policies might vary. Observing the procedure can offer convenience, yet some scenarios might call for the proprietor to step out for safety and security reasons.
